A leading retail company in Brighton seeks a Sales Consultant to provide exceptional customer service in a vibrant retail environment. You will build strong relationships with customers and have the opportunity to thrive in achieving sales targets.
The role offers 12 contracted hours per week, with perks including a generous 50% staff discount and a performance-related bonus, fostering a dynamic and inclusive workplace culture.

How to prepare for a job interview at Ann Summers
✨Know the Company
Before your interview, take some time to research the retail company. Understand their values, products, and what makes them stand out in Brighton. This will help you tailor your answers and show that you're genuinely interested in being part of their team.
✨Showcase Your Customer Service Skills
As a Sales Consultant, exceptional customer service is key. Prepare examples from your past experiences where you've gone above and beyond for a customer. This will demonstrate your ability to build strong relationships and thrive in a sales environment.
✨Dress the Part
First impressions matter! Dress smartly and appropriately for the retail environment. Aim for a polished look that reflects the company's culture while ensuring you feel comfortable and confident during the interview.
✨Prepare Questions
At the end of the interview, you'll likely have the chance to ask questions. Prepare thoughtful questions about the role, team dynamics, or company culture. This shows your enthusiasm and helps you determine if it's the right fit for you.
